SF260

Have a look at a Siai Marchetti SF260, I have had one for 25 years and can't think of anything else that ticks so many boxes. 170kts cruise at 50 litres per hour, low wing, a sturdy O-540 six cylinder up front, 4 seats, aerobatic handling like a swept wing jet and at 1102kgs max weight cheap(er) landing fees. OK, the 250 lbs weight limit on the rear seat means the two kids in the back will have to be off loaded once they grow too big, but by then they won't want to come on holidays with you and the wife in any case. It's different, looks great and always draws a crowd; parts are easy as they still make them after a 43 year production run with nearly 1000 units sold to date.
The only problem is finding one as no one who owns one can find anything better! Be carefull, the ex-military ones can't get a full CofA, and they aren't suited to short strips at anything near max weight. I'm 6ft and have plenty of room, and visibility is superb with the large canopy.
